Serving Children with Special Care Needs

Description: This course equips childcare professionals with best practices for supporting young children with disabilities in inclusive early learning environments. Participants will explore respectful, person-first terminology, gain an understanding of disabilities commonly seen in early childhood, and learn practical strategies to support each child’s unique strengths and needs. The course emphasizes creating inclusive environments that foster belonging, collaboration with families, and compliance with applicable legal and regulatory requirements.

By the end of this course you will be able to...

  • Identify disabilities commonly observed in young children and describe how these disabilities may impact development, learning, and participation in daily routines. 
  • Apply inclusive teaching and caregiving strategies that support the individual needs of children with disabilities within typical early childhood settings. 
  • Create an inclusive learning environment that supports children with disabilities and their families while aligning with legal frameworks and licensing requirements related to serving children with special care needs.
